Therein, :the game apparatus or device comprises a'stationary base IE1 having an upright shaft or ifpos't' l2 secured thereto. 25.
" the center thereof in any suitable manner and Preferabl as shown the base 'is circular and the post 12 is fixed to extends upwardly vertically therefrom. Carried f'o'n the post is an assembly or series of rotatable "jrnernbers in the form of discs M which are of unequal diameters. These discs are arranged in fprqgressive order from the largest nearest the ".bas'e to the smallest at the top of the assembly. j'lhe discs' are axially bored so as to rotatably jandslidably fit the post without lateral play.
"Mounted in thisinanner, the upper exposed peripheral margins'of the discs are exposed to view j from thietop. Carried on these exposed marginal portions are indicia means in the form of symbols or characters for whatever game the device is intended .HQEOI playing card games, the peripheral portions i the discs may carr the playing card characters c cumferenti'ally spaced therearound as shown by registered set of such characters I 6 in Fig. 1 In ig. the two smallest discs of the assembly are with the peripheral portions thereof carryingjsniall circumferentially spaced rectangular paper sections I8 upon which the playing card characters orother game symbols may be printed.
secured to the marginal portions of the discs as Thesepa'per sections may be separately adhesively shown or be mounted on annular strips and applied "totheir respective discs as a unit. For a playing hand of five cards; such as poker, where the deck consists of fifty-two playing cards, it is preferred to use five discs, three of the smaller discs exhibiting ten diiferent playing card characters and the two remaining larger discs exhibiting eleven different playing card characters thereby making up the fifty-two cards in a deck.
The discs are freely individually rotatable about the post 92 and relative rotation of the discs with respect to one another will form many combinations of characters radially of the post. To conceal all but one radially aligned combination of characters and to provide a compact housing for the moving parts of apparatus, the device is provided with a top which is generally in the form of an inverted cup-shaped member which forms a chamber 22 in which the discs are mounted. The lower edges of the top shaped member are secured in any suitable way to the base such as by a series of circularly spaced countersunk screws. The to and base members may be of any suitable material but preferably the top is formed of relatively opaque plastic material which may be colored in a highly attractive manner. At one point in the top member overlying the peripheral portions of the disc, a radially extending opening or slot 2e is provided which is of such width as to expose only one set of aligned characters It as shown in Fig. l. The central portion of the top member is thickened to provide an upwardly extending boss 26 around the upper end of the post l2. In axial alignment with the post, a circular hole 28 is formed in the boss and the post may be of such length as to extend through this opening beyond the upper limits of the top member as shown in Fig. 3.
A novel spinner control member for imparting rotation to the discs is slidably telescopingly received over the upper end of the post l2. It comprises an elongated hollowed cylindrical portion 3!] widening at the lower end to form a circular driving head 32. The latter is wider than the hole 28 to prevent withdrawal of the control member from the top of the device. It is assembled on the post 62 before the top member is secured to the base. The driving head portion 32 of the spinner is disposed in a circular recess 34 of the boss 25. The spinner is axially bored to provide a passage therein having two sections of different diameters. The wider section 3% of the passage opens out through the bottom of the head. In the normal inoperative position of the spinner as shown in Fig. 3, the narrower section 38 of the passage extends upwardly a considerable distance beyond the inserted end of the post [2 in order that the spinner may be depressed upon the post to the operating position illustrated in Fig. 4. The upper outside surface of the spinner is preferably ribbed or knurled to facilitate rotation between the thumb and forefinger of a hand.
Projecting from the bottom of the head portion 32 of the spinner between the passage section 36 and the outside periphery is a depending driving element or pin 4%. At the same radial distance from the axis of the post as the pin 40 is therefrom each disc 34 is provided with a series of arcuate openings or slots 42 circularly spaced therearound as shown in Fig. 2. The slots are wider than the diameter of the pin to permit the pin to be easily entered into the slots when the spinner member is depressed. When thus inserted the pin couples the discs to the spinner for joint rotation.
The assembly of discs 14 is mounted on the post in a novel manner for bodily movement axially of the post as well as rotatable thereabout. Yieldingly bearing against the underside of the disc assembly is an elastic device in the form of a spring 14 which resistingly permits the discs as a group to be bodily shifted down the post. The spring however is of such a strength as to normally raise the discs to the upper part of the chamber 22. In order to permit this bodily movement, the overall thickness of the disc assembly in a vertical direction is substantially less than the vertical height of the chamber as is evident in Figs. 3 and 4. The spring 4 3 encircles the post i2 as shown and is preferably conical in formation to permit collapse of the individual coils upon themselves. Disposed between the upper end of the spring 44 and the disc assembly is a thin washer it which distributes the pressure of the spring equally on the bottom discs and provides a bearing surface for the latter to rotate freely.
Yieldingly bearing against the upper side of the disc assembly and interposed between the same and the spinner control member 3% is a second elastic device in the form of a coiled spring 48. The latter encircles the post and is seated at its lower end on a washer element which bears against the topmost disc and is similarly seated at its upper end on a washer which is tensioned by the spring against the shoulder formed by the juncture of the two sections 36 and 38 of the spinner passage. Spring 38 is of less strength than spring 44 but has sufficient force to raise the spinner member relative to the disc assembly and withdraw the pin 40 from the slots 42.
Novel means is provided for quickly stopping the rotation of the discs after they have been raised to their upper position in the chamber 22. This means includes a pointed element or pin 59 which is fixed to a stationary part of the apparatus and preferably as shown to the bottom side of the boss portion 26 in radial alignment with the viewing slot 24. This pin is located at a radial distance from the post I2 greater than the driving pin All and is mounted so that it projects downwardly into the chamber 22. At the same distance from the axis of the post l2 as the stop pin 56, each disc M is provided with a series of circularly spaced openings or apertures 52 which correspond in number to the number of indicia or characters carried by the disc in radial alignment therewith. These apertures are preferably circular as shown in Fig. 2 and of a size to closely receive the stop pin 50. The projecting pointed end of the latter extends into the chamber a distance equal to the thickness of the disc assembly. It is evident that when the discs are raised into position to receive the stop pin and the latter projects through one aperture of each series of apertures 52 in all the discs, a combination of characters in radial alignment will be seen through the opening 24.
To operate the apparatus, the control member 3! which functions both as a plunger and spinner, is pressed downwardly into the chamber 22, overcoming both the weaker spring 48 and the stronger spring 44. Since the weaker spring will be compressed first, the driving pin in the initial depressing movements will advance upon and enter the arcuate openings 62 in the discs. ally these openings have already been brought into overlapping registration by the stop pin and the driving pin will penetrate these openings Without difiiculty. In the event the arcuate openings 42 are not all in registration for receiving the driving pin, a slight oscillating movement of the spinner as it is depressed will assure penetration of the driving pin into all the openings. stronger spring is overcome, allowing the group of discs to be shifted bodily down the post and outof engagement with the stop pin. The control member and the discs may be depressed to the extent shown in Fig. 4. When free of the stop pin, the discs may be rapidly rotated by giving the spinner a quick turn. Immediately thereafter the spinner is quickly released and the upper spring 48 throws the spinner upwardly relative to the disc's, releasing the driving pin from its engagement with the discs and allowing the discs to rotate freely and independently about the post l2.
Due to the centrifugal force set up by the rotation of the discs and the slower action of the lower spring '44 due to the weight of the discs, the discs do not rise directly with the spinner but rotate freely for a short interval of time while they are being bodily elevated by the spring. As the rotating discs approach the top of the chamber the apertures 52 are caused to pass beneath the pin 50 and each disc is successively stopped as it presents an aperture to the pin and the disc moves upwardly thereover. The several discs of the assembly will therefore be stopped at such a position that a combination of symbols, such as playing card characters, will be visible through the opening 24.
Figs. 5, 6 and 7 illustrate modifications of the embodiment of the invention previously described. The discs 14 are shown as independently rotatably mounted on a sleeve 54 which in turn is slidably mounted on the post 12. The upper and lower edges of the sleeve are peened or flanged outwardly to hold the discs together as a group. The flanged edges however do not exert any compression on the discs and the latter are free to rotate independently of one another. The springs 44 and 48 are seated on washers 56 which bear on the flanged portions of the sleeve as shown rather than directly on the top and bottom discs of the previous embodiment of the invention. The sleeve rather than the discs takes the load of the springs. Preferably the discs are interleaved with thin Washers 58 to improve their freedom of rotation relative to one another.
In Figs. 6 and 'Z 'a novel one-way drive is provided for imparting rotation to the discs. A pin 46 which corresponds to the driving pin 45 of the previous embodiment of the invention is pivotally mounted in the driving head 32 of the spinner. The latter is provided with a general triangularly shaped recess 3% opening out through the bottom and having a vertical side and an inclined'side- 64. The upper end of the pin 49 is pivoted about a horizontal axis formed by a small cross pin '56. Normally the pin 40' will project downwardly as shown in Fig. 6 for entering the 'arcuate slots 42 previously described. Th'e'side 62 of the recess'serves as a stop limiting the swing of the driving pin in that direction. The spatial relation of the inclined side 64 of the recess to the driving pin permits the latter to swing in that direction until the lower extremity is brought substantially within the driving head of the spinner.
An importantresult is derived from the modification of Figs. 5 and 6. Instead of having to quickly release the spinner immediately after the discs are rotated as in the previous embodiment'of the invention,'the swingable or collapsible character of the drive pin 40 enables the operator to hold the disc series down in the chamber while they rotate for an interval of time before releasing the spinner and allowing the discs to be raised by the spring "44. operating the modification of Figs. 5 and 6, the operates presses the-spinner and thereby engages the drive pin 45 with thediscs in the manner-previously described. In this position if the spinner is rotated in one direction the pin 40 merely "col lapses in the recess 53 without impartin rotanot to the discs. However, rotation o'f the spinher in the other direction will bring the up against the vertical wall 620i the recess where it is held v'ertical projecting position and caused to drive the discs. As soonasithe 'opeifa'ftor slows or s'tops rotation of the spinner, the rotating discs will raise the pin 40 into the re cess ti: and freely'overrun the spinner. The op": erator may therefore hold the spinner down for an interval of time after he has imparted arapid rotation-tothe discs and then release hishold the spinner to allow it to rise to its initial inop erative position.
